Step 1: Prepare Your Master and Workspace
Begin by selecting your master—the object you wish to replicate. Make sure it is clean, dry, and free from dust or oils, as any surface debris will be copied into your mould. Position the master in a container or create a simple frame around it with non-porous material, leaving a minimum 1 cm clearance around all sides for adequate silicone coverage. On especially intricate or porous items, apply a suitable release agent to ensure removal from the finished mould is effortless and minimises damage to both master and mould.
Arrange your workspace so everything you need is to hand, and work on a flat, stable surface to prevent spillage or uneven moulds. This stage is crucial for safety and for achieving crisp results.
Step 2: Mix and Prepare the Silicone Rubber
Following your chosen silicone’s package instructions, accurately weigh and mix the two components. Most liquid silicones like “Pure Mould” – Translucent Liquid Silicone Rubber for Mould Making use a 1:1 ratio, making precise measurement straightforward. Mix slowly to minimise air bubbles, scraping the sides and bottom of your container to ensure complete blending. Inadequate mixing results in sticky or uncured spots, so take your time for a perfect consistency. Have your mould container ready as some products begin to cure quickly.
Step 3: Pour or Apply the Silicone Rubber
For liquid silicone rubber, pour slowly from one corner and allow the silicone to flow over and around your master. Pouring from higher up creates a thin stream, helping release trapped air. For putty, press and mould the silicone directly onto and around the master, making sure the coverage is even and there are no gaps.
Tapping or gently vibrating the mould container can encourage air bubbles to rise and escape before curing. Avoid pouring too quickly or moving the mould, which can distort the result.
Step 4: Allow the Mould to Cure Fully
Leave the silicone mould undisturbed for the recommended cure time. Typical cure times range from 20 minutes (putty) up to 12 hours (liquid silicone), depending on your chosen product and room temperature. Avoid moving, poking, or demoulding before the silicone is completely set to maintain fine details and structural strength.
Do not attempt to accelerate curing with heat unless specifically recommended, as this can compromise flexibility or accuracy.
Step 5: Demould and Inspect Your Silicone Rubber Mould
Carefully remove the mould container walls or frame, then gently peel the mould away from your master item. Silicone’s flexibility enables easy demoulding even from undercuts, but take care with delicate models to avoid tearing. Inspect for bubbles, incomplete coverage, or surface imperfections before using your mould for further casting.
Your mould is now ready for use with resins, wax, plaster, or other casting materials.
Tips, Common Mistakes, and Troubleshooting
- Plan your mould before starting – Consider the master’s shape, undercuts, and how best to position your item for a clean pour and easy removal.
- Use release agent for easier demoulding – Especially important for intricate models or porous masters.
- Mix silicone thoroughly and precisely – Inaccurate ratios or poor mixing can result in sticky or weak moulds.
- Avoid air bubbles for crisp detail – Pour slowly, or use a pressure pot if professional bubble-free results are needed.
- Cure at the recommended temperature – Room temperature is best unless the silicone’s instructions suggest otherwise.
- Patience pays off: Rushing can ruin even the best-prepared mould.

Frequently Asked Questions
How long does it take silicone rubber moulds to cure?
Cure times range from 20 minutes for putty to 3-12 hours for liquid silicone, depending on the product and room temperature.
Do I need to use a release agent with silicone moulds?
Using a release agent is recommended for intricate or porous masters, though for smoother objects it might not be essential.
How can I prevent air bubbles in silicone moulds?
Pour silicone slowly in a thin stream and gently tap or vibrate the mould container. Professional users may use a pressure pot.
Can I use the same silicone mould for multiple casting materials?
Yes, silicone rubber moulds can be used with resins, plaster, cement, wax, and similar materials as long as the material is compatible.
What if my silicone mould did not cure properly?
Sticky or soft moulds are often due to incorrect mixing or ratios. Dispose and restart with precise measurements and thorough mixing.
Which type of silicone rubber is best for high detail?
Liquid silicone rubbers are ideal for fine details, while putty is best for quick moulds or less intricate items.
How do I store silicone moulds for longevity?
Keep your moulds clean, dry, and away from direct sunlight or extreme heat to maintain their flexibility and detail.
